271449 2004-09-12 04:48:00 I would think most ISPs don't like you running servers.
Xtra made a big fuss about people using Kazaa as technically that would mean uploading and therefore running a server.

I'm with Orcon - no real complaints. Email goes down from time to time but then I guess you get that with any ISP.

When Jetstream goes down it's usually Telecom's fault.

I was on Orcon dialup before Jetstart. At one point I almost packed it in because I couldn't log on. Perhaps they were overloaded. The problem went away so I assume they fixed it. I haven't had any such problem with them on ADSL.

I like the unlimited cap and they're good value all in all. Customer service might not be 24/7 like Xtra perhaps, but I wouldn't touch Xtra for 2 reasons: 1) They're Telecom in disguise 2) too expensive.

Stick with Orcon and you won't be disappointed.
